The Production Process of Clean Coal Powder


The production of clean coal powder involves several meticulous steps:

Raw Coal Preparation: Raw coal is screened through a grid sieve and conveyed to a large-angle belt conveyor or elevator. After electromagnetic iron removal, the coal is stored in a raw coal bunker.

Milling and Drying: Once the milling system is activated, the raw coal is fed into a vertical coal mill for drying and grinding. Hot air or exhaust gas from a hot-air stove enters the mill under the suction of a system fan, exchanging heat with the coal being ground.

Classification and Collection: The coal powder is then carried by the airflow and classified in a separator. Coarse coal powder that fails to meet the fineness standard falls back onto the grinding table for further milling. Qualified coal powder is collected in an explosion-proof air box pulse dust collector and discharged into a coal powder bunker.

Impurity Removal: Impurities such as coal gangue and metal fragments are removed through the air ring and spit outlet.

Characteristics of the Clean Coal Powder Production Process


Clean coal powder, characterized by high purity, low sulfur, and low ash content, offers several advantages:

Enhanced Combustion Efficiency: Clean coal powder burns more efficiently, fully releasing coal's energy and improving energy utilization.

Reduced Pollutant Emissions: With significantly lower pollutant emissions, clean coal powder contributes to reduced atmospheric pollution and improved environmental quality.

Economic Benefits: Higher combustion efficiency leads to energy savings and cost reductions, enhancing the economic performance of enterprises.


Types of Coal Grinding Mills


Our range of coal grinding mills includes various models tailored to different production needs:

Vertical Mills: Suitable for grinding a wide range of materials, including coal, with high efficiency and low energy consumption.

Raymond Mills: Known for their fine grinding capabilities and wide application in various industries.

Ultra-Fine Grinding Mills: Designed for producing ultra-fine coal powder, meeting the requirements of high-precision applications.
